Hello all. I have the laptop hp 250 g6 (1WY58EA) which has an ssd 256gb, i5 7th gen, 8gb ram and DVD driver. I have 2 questions.
1) Can I add a new HDD (no need to boot from it), without removing the dvd drive? If i have to remove the dvd drive what adapter will I need?
2) Is it possible to upgrade to 16GB ram?
Thanks in advance and sorry if the questions have been posted again.

Supports a maximum of 16 gb of ram.
DDR4-2133 dual channel support (DDR4-2400 bridge to DDR4-2133)
DDR4-2400 For use in models with 6th and 7th generation Intel Core processors
● 8-GB 862398-855
● 4 GB 862397-855
● 2 GB 864271-855

Hi.
1-Reviewing the information provided by Hp, your computer does not support a dual HDD + SSD configuration.
If you still want to add a hard drive you should put it where the DVD is:
1-TB, 5400 rpm, 9.5 mm or 7.2 mm
500-GB, 5400/7200 rpm, 7.0-mm
1-TB, 5400-rpm 778192-005
500-GB, 7200-rpm 703267-005
500-GB, 5400-rpm 778186-005
Checking the measurements of the optical drive you can put a hard drive
Optical drive Fixed, serial ATA, 9.0-mm tray load
You need an adapter and cables.
2-To know the ram memory your computer supports, you must know what processor it has so that it can verify what it supports:https://support.hp.com/us-en/product/hp-250-g6-notebook-pc/15747807/document/c05478277
